Output d8475341057c81fc3046dc0a117b652399cc2536c705d92392ea318ab5fcd437:1

value
1313583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f4866e0ce0202065f1065d763aa4e2629df8eb6 OP_EQUAL
address
2MzUS71SuhXkQkEp2FAiFJqP1DDKNfuuhBu
transaction
d8475341057c81fc3046dc0a117b652399cc2536c705d92392ea318ab5fcd437